Tips for Your Digital Marketing Analyst Internship Search
Start your search earlier than you think
Large employers recruit summer digital marketing analyst interns the preceding fall, with some application windows opening in September. Smaller companies and co-op programs post closer to start dates, so openings appear year-round. Checking now rather than waiting for a single season means you catch the full range of opportunities.
Build a portfolio before you apply
Hiring teams for digital marketing analyst intern roles expect limited work history and look for something concrete to assess instead. Create two or three documented projects, a channel performance analysis, an SEO audit, or a paid-media case study, using tools like Google Analytics, SEMrush, or Excel, and link them directly from your resume.
Combine campus recruiting with direct applications
Campus career fairs surface structured programs tied to your university, and recruiters there often move faster for students they meet in person. Professors and career center staff frequently know which employers recruit from your school before roles post publicly. Applying directly to companies running smaller digital marketing analyst cohorts alongside campus activity widens the pool you reach.
Practice the digital marketing analyst intern screen out loud
Most digital marketing analyst intern interviews include a case or analytics exercise, you may be given a dataset, a campaign scenario, or a channel performance problem and asked to walk through your reasoning. Practice explaining your thought process aloud, not just reaching an answer, since interviewers weigh how you think as much as the conclusion.
Target structured rotational and cohort programs early
Larger companies in marketing, media, and technology run cohort-based digital marketing analyst internship programs built to train people new to the field. These programs recruit early and fill fast. Identify the ones that align with your interests and apply in the first wave rather than waiting until the broader posting appears.

Digital Marketing Analyst Internships: Frequently Asked Questions
How do I get a digital marketing analyst internship?
Lead with coursework, personal projects, and a portfolio rather than work history, hiring teams expect limited experience at the intern level. For digital marketing analyst candidates, a portfolio of campaign analyses, SEO audits, or paid-media case studies gives recruiters something concrete to assess. Pair direct applications with campus career fairs, where recruiters often move faster for students they meet in person.
Can a digital marketing analyst internship turn into a full-time job?
Many employers extend return offers to strong interns, but conversion is never guaranteed. For digital marketing analyst interns, what drives it most is performance on real campaign or analytics work, available headcount on the team, and whether the employer's return-offer timeline aligns with your graduation date. Position for one by delivering measurable results, but don't count on it when evaluating an offer.
When should I apply for digital marketing analyst internships?
Earlier than most candidates expect. Large employers recruit summer cohorts the preceding fall, so applications at major agencies and tech companies often open in September and October. Smaller companies and co-op programs post closer to start dates, which means openings appear year-round. Checking regularly rather than waiting for a single recruiting season gives you the widest window.
Are digital marketing analyst internships paid?
Most professional digital marketing analyst internships in the U.S. are paid. Compensation varies by company size, industry, and location, and listings show it where the employer chooses to disclose it. Stipend-only or unpaid arrangements exist but are less common at companies running structured intern programs.
What should a digital marketing analyst internship resume include?
Lead with two or three complete projects that show the tools you used and where the work can be seen, for digital marketing analyst candidates, that means linked campaign reports, published analyses, or documented SEO or paid-media case studies. Add relevant coursework, any analytics or platform certifications, and keep the whole document to one page.

Can international students get digital marketing analyst internships?
Yes. F-1 students can intern through CPT while enrolled or through OPT work authorization after finishing a degree, and the employer does not have to file anything for either, so many companies are open to international interns. Confirm your eligibility and timing with your university's international student office before accepting an offer.
